Understanding Bladder Infections and Their Symptoms

A bladder infection occurs when bacteria, most commonly Escherichia coli, colonize the urinary tract. This invasion triggers an inflammatory response, leading to a range of uncomfortable symptoms. Recognizing these signs early allows for prompt intervention, whether through medical treatment or supportive essential oil therapy.

Common Indicators of Infection

A burning sensation during urination.

Frequent, urgent need to void small amounts of urine.

Cloudy or strong-smelling urine often accompanies these primary indicators. Some individuals may also experience pelvic pressure or general malaise, signaling that the infection requires attention.

Precautions and Professional Guidance

While essential oils for bladder infection offer significant benefits, they are not a standalone cure for severe cases. Medical evaluation is necessary to prevent the infection from ascending to the kidneys. Pregnant women, children, and individuals with chronic conditions should exercise heightened caution.
